Explore the wines of Harlan Estate, one of Napa Valley's most iconic and highly acclaimed wineries, during a rare seminar with Founding Winemaker Bob Levy and Founding Director Don Weaver. Through a curated tasting of select vintages, experience the power, grace, and longevity that define Harlan Estate's wines.
Learn about the estate's founding vision, farming practices, cellar techniques, and enduring, multi-generational commitment to expressing, through the medium of wine, the elusive soul of this land in the western hills of Oakville, California. Whether you are a collector or simply curious about fine winemaking, this seminar offers an unforgettable glimpse into Harlan Estate's artistry.
